Metalsa is a global manufacturer specializing in structural components for light and commercial vehicles, including chassis frames, body structural stampings, and assemblies for passenger cars, buses, and heavy and light trucks. Headquartered in Monterrey, Mexico, the company has over 60 years of experience in the automotive industry. Metalsa’s light vehicle division is located in Apodaca, Nuevo León.

Even the most innovative manufacturers can run into challenges when it comes to logistics. For Metalsa, an industry-leading structural components manufacturer for light vehicles, keeping up with a high volume of shipments in a 24/7 operation was becoming increasingly complex—especially to manage shipments originating in the U.S. with Mexican destinations. Their logistics processes were still largely manual, requiring multiple communication steps to track shipments and ensure on-time deliveries.
With time-sensitive deadlines to supply original equipment manufacturers across the globe, including Toyota and Stellantis, with critical chassis parts across a mix of rail and truck—managing both inbound and outbound deliveries efficiently was a growing challenge. They needed a better way to consolidate shipment information into a single, real-time source of truth that would provide the visibility and control needed to keep operations running smoothly.

Metalsa has gained the visibility and control needed to streamline decision-making, improve processes, and drive cost savings. The ability to manage shipments through a single platform—combining TMS capabilities with Uber Freight’s brokerage services—has led to a more efficient, modernized approach to logistics.
By using Uber Freight’s Managed Transportation Services, Metalsa has achieved:
- 95% on time pick-up
- 95% on time delivery
- 100% tender acceptance
- 98% check call compliance
- 98% check call timeliness
This increased visibility and optimization have also resulted in significant savings for Metalsa, with annual inbound transportation costs reduced by nearly 10%.

Solution: End-to-end visibility and dynamic capacity through managed transportation
Through Uber Freight’s Managed Transportation Services, Metalsa’s entire logistics operation functions like a well-oiled machine.
With its Transportation Management System (TMS), Uber Freight manages everything from Metalsa’s inbound parts and raw materials to outbound finished products heading to OEM customers all in one place—optimizing routes, improving planning, and handling carrier tendering. Uber Freight collaboratively oversees Metalsa’s shipment planning, carrier assignments and rate maintenance, freight audits, dock scheduling, cargo claims, and more, enabling real-time visibility into Metalsa’s shipment statuses through GPS tracking.
Uber Freight also handles, manages, and controls all of Metalsa’s legacy carriers, as well as newer carriers onboarded by Uber Freight, leveraging the entire Uber Freight vetted and approved carrier base.
Since integrating Uber Freight’s brokerage arm, Metalsa has been able to source and track capacity and loads in real-time, as well as access highly responsive live load and post-delivery support, which has unlocked additional savings for their inbound logistics.
Using Uber Freight's BI reporting, Metalsa accesses detailed data analytics and insights about their expansive logistics network through Insights AI, including weekly and monthly KPI reporting. They’re able to create personalized dashboards to focus on the most relevant metrics for their cross-border business, including cost analysis, delivery times, carrier compliance, CO2 emissions, and route optimization. With added insights into their rail and ocean freight, Metalsa now has a comprehensive, tech-driven approach to managing their complex, high-volume logistics operations.
